Output 18f1f7be18b5820d8a8fd75280aaa15015606d4914b2202b4f2327c3c27437a5:0

value
3675802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72107bfea8b39f471a8f5a7b8f6dbab72b3e552f OP_EQUAL
address
3C68hmMEyt7M9jf1PUEKU4Dw7aSLWLPSVo
transaction
18f1f7be18b5820d8a8fd75280aaa15015606d4914b2202b4f2327c3c27437a5
confirmations
281413
spent
true